The problem with this plan is that waiting between 9.2 & 10.0 is going to take a long time. It's part of what Blizz has constantly gotten hit by in every expansion...the long wait between the final raid patch & the next expansion coming out. Not having a 9.2.5 means not having something to keep the momentum going, and WoW feeds on momentum strongly. Having a 9.2.5 gives at least a small bump to keep players a bit more interested and/or with things to do until 10.0 comes out.
I'm not saying it has to be huge, but it should do something to keep the players interested. A couple story quests, maybe some heritage armor, perhaps even an early release of a new BG or races/classes if any are slated for 10.0. After all, look how good 7.3.5 did with the Allied Races & Seething Shore to keep people playing until BfA was released.
